Business For Sale Tips

Entrepreneurship does not come without risks, and the necessity to increase the security of the investment is to have solid info about the business for sale and its fiscal status. There is a price to pay when you make a buy a successful business for sale, the costs are a lot higher than if the company would have been on the verge of bankruptcy. Moreover, you'd pay more money when purchasing a business than you'd need to start one. There are very complicated issues behind the merger or the taking over of one company by another one and all need to be cover in detail so that no problems may appear later.

What Areas are assessed in the SAS 70 Audits?

There are two different types of SAS70 audits. These are simply labeled as 'Type 1' and 'Type 2.' There is a little bit of a difference between the two based on what it is that needs to be reviewed within a particular company. As for the company that must undergo the audit, any company working in the services industry that handles customer information that, if compromised, could cause harm to the customer, must be audited.
